Включение неуправляемых библиотек ImageMagick в .NET Wrapper - PullRequest
2 голосов
/ 10 октября 2011

Я пытаюсь использовать оболочку ImageMagick.NET в одном из моих веб-приложений для сжатия, масштабирования и обрезки файлов JPEG (я знаю, что существует миллиард других библиотек, но они слишком медленные для моих нужд).Я считаю, что у меня работает оболочка (хотя у нее могут быть проблемы с повреждением памяти; но это не имеет отношения к моему вопросу).

У меня нет большого опыта работы с CLI, поэтому мне было интересно, как я могу получитьобертка, чтобы включить все необходимые зависимости.В настоящее время вам необходимо установить ImageMagick, и он создает значение реестра с путем к файлу, который указывает на эти библиотеки.Оболочка читает реестр, и вот как он находит библиотеки.

Я хочу обойти это, и оболочка просто использует dll, когда они находятся в одной корневой папке (без чтения реестра).Возможно ли это?

Вот ссылка на созданную оболочку: http://imagemagick.codeplex.com/ (хотя я не думаю, что она когда-либо была закончена, но достаточно для моих нужд).

Вот ссылка на то, что он на самом деле упаковывает: http://www.imagemagick.org/script/index.php

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...